Read, understand and follow all instructions:
DANGER

 Risk of accidental drowning: 

- Extreme caution must be exercised to prevent unauthorized access by children.

- Inspect the spa cover regularly for leak, premature wear and tear, damage or signs of deterioration.

Never use a worn or damaged cover: it will not provide the level of protection required to prevent unsuper-

vised access to the spa by a child.

- Always lock the spa cover after each use.

Risk of injury:

The suction fittings in this spa are sized to match the specific water flow created by the pump.
Never operate the spa if the suction fittings are broken or missing. Never replace a suction fitting with an

incompatible one.

If the supply cord is damaged, it must be replaced by the manufacturer, its service agent or similarly quali-

fied persons in order to avoid a hazard.

 Risk of Electric Shock: 

- Do not permit any electrical appliances, such as a light, telephone, radio or television within 1.5m (5 feet)

of a spa tub.

- Do not use the spa when it is raining, thundering or lightning..

WARNING

 To reduce the risk of electric shock, do not use an extension cord, timers, plug adapters or converter 

plugs to connect the unit to electric supply; provide a properly located outlet.

 The spa electrical appliance should be supplied through a residual current device (RCD) having a rated 

residual operating current not exceeding 10mA.

 Parts containing live parts, except parts supplied with safety extra-low voltage not exceeding 12V, must 

be inaccessible to occupants in the spa.

 Parts incorporating electrical components, except remote control devices, must be located or fixed so 

that they cannot fall into the spa.

 Residential electrical connection box must be located safely with a distance of at least 2m away from the 

spa.

 Electric installation should fulfill the local requirement or standards.

 This appliance can be used by children aged from 8 years and above and persons with reduced physi-

cal, sensory or mental capabilities or lack of experience and knowledge if they have been given supervi-

sion or instruction concerning use of the appliance in a safe way and understand the hazards involved. 

Children shall not play with the appliance. Cleaning and user maintenance shall not be made by children 

without supervision.

 To reduce the risk or injury, do not permit children use this product unless they are closely supervised all 

times.

 To reduce the risk of child drowning, supervise children all times. Attach and lock spa cover after each 

use.

 Make sure the floor is capable of supporting the expected load (≥ 500kg/m²).
 Adequate draining system must be provided around the spa to deal with overflow water.

 To avoid damage do not leave the appliance empty for an extended period.

 To avoid damage to the pump, the spa must never be operated unless the spa is filled with water.

I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S

 Immediately leave spa if uncomfortable or sleepy.
 To reduce the risk of injury :

- Lower water temperatures are recommended for young children and when spa use exceeds 10 minutes.

In order to avoid the possibility of hyperthermia (heat stress) occurring it is recommended that the average

temperature of spa-pool water should not exceed 40°C (104°F).
- Since excessive water temperatures have a high potential for causing fetal damage during the early

months of pregnancy, pregnant or possibly pregnant women should limit spa water temperatures to 38°C

(100°F).
- Before entering a spa or hot tub the user should measure the water temperature with an accurate ther-

mometer since the tolerance of water temperature regulating devices varies.
- The use of alcohol, drugs or medication before or during spa use may lead to unconsciousness with the

possibility or drowning.
- The use of alcohol, drugs, or medication can greatly increase the risk of fatal hyperthermia in spas.
The causes and symptoms of hyperthermia may be described as follows:
Hyperthermia occurs when the internal temperature of body reaches a level several degrees above 

the normal body temperature 37°C (98.6°F). The symptoms of hyperthermia include an increase in the 

internal temperature of body, dizziness, lethargy, drowsiness, and fainting. The effect of hyperemia include 

failure to perceive heat; failure to recognize the need to exit spa; unawareness of impending hazard; fetal 

damage in pregnant women; physical inability to exit the spa; and unconsciousness resulting in the danger 

of drowning.
- Obese persons or persons with a history of heart disease, low or high blood pressure, circulatory system

problem, or diabetes should consult a physician before using a spa.
- Persons using medication should consult a physician before using a spa since some medication may

induce drowsiness while other medication may affect heart rate, blood pressure and circulation.
- Check with doctor before use if pregnant, diabetic, in poor health, or under medical care.

People with infectious disease should not use a spa or hot tub.
To avoid injury exercise care when entering or existing the spa or hot tub.
Water temperature in excess of 40°C (104°F) may be injurious to your health.
Never use a spa or hot tub alone or allow others to use the spa alone.
Do not use a spa or hot tub immediately following strenuous exercise.
